Lysine lactylation (Kla) links lactate metabolism to epigenetic regulation, playing a key role in modulation of gene expression in tumor and immune microenvironment. Our recent study shows that HBO1-mediated histone H3K9la activates the transcription of genes encoding tumorigenesis, suggesting the potential significance of intervening in this Kla site for tumor therapy.
